Sha256: 52be9fb1deb14d0be591b452b3490fbb2f7ecba6f06249a79cad53737aecd52f
Contents?: true
Size: 770 Bytes
Versions: 19
Compression:
Stored size: 770 Bytes
Contents
'use strict'; var FsTools = require('../'); var Helper = require('./helper'); var Assert = require('assert'); var SANDBOX = Helper.SANDBOX_DIR + '/find-sorted'; require('vows').describe('findSorted()').addBatch({ 'found files in deirectory': { topic: function () { FsTools.findSorted(SANDBOX, this.callback); }, 'should return sorted list of file': function (err, files) { Assert.ok(!err, 'Has no errors'); files = files.map(function (f) { return f.replace(SANDBOX, ''); }); Assert.deepEqual(files, [ '/file', '/foo/bar/baz/file', '/foo/bar/baz/link', '/foo/bar/file', '/foo/bar/link', '/foo/file', '/foo/link', '/link' ]); } } }).export(module);
Version data entries
19 entries across 19 versions & 1 rubygems